Beaches are the key motivation for the Chinese, Asian and Australian groups (96%, 92%, 86% respectively); Europeans are less attracted by the beaches (67%) but are more attracted by Bali’s warm climate (70%). In terms of culture, local food is a significant motivation driver for the groups (above 60% for the Australian, Asian and Chinese groups); Palaces and traditional villages were other popular cultural motivations. Shopping was a more popular activity with the Asian and the Chinese groups (80% and 68% respectively), While interest in more upmarket experiences (such as spas wellbeing resorts) is the highest among the Chinese group (64%). Museums were the least popular motivation driver across the four groups (Australia – 14%; Asia – 29%; China – 26%; and Europe – 17%). Another less popular motivation driver was interest in flora and fauna, although the interest in the other natural environment features (such as lakes and volcanoes, climate and beaches) was very high.
